Chapter 603: Chapter 482: There’s No Place Like Home

Early the next morning, as soon as the bugle sounded, Zhang Guoqing got up, just as Zhou Jiao followed him, "Sleep a little longer, it’s still early now."

"No, today don’t go running, accompany Dad for a walk around the Big Courtyard."

"Alright. I’ll first check if the three little guys next door are awake."

In the study, as soon as Xi Zi saw him come in, he immediately got up and pointed at Ziwen and Ping’an, "Should I wake them up?"

Zhang Guoqing ruffled his short hair and laughed, "Let them sleep. Ping’an won’t wake up even if you call him now; when it’s time, he’ll come out on his own."

"Uncle, this place is really big. We drove for so long yesterday."

Zhang Guoqing picked up some clothes and tossed them to him, "This is just the beginning. This time, Uncle will take you all for a good tour around. If you need anything, just ask your Aunt."

After instructing the child, he left the room and found that everyone was already up. Even his mother-in-law, who always woke up late, was with his mother in the kitchen.

Seeing the two fathers walking out of the courtyard together, Zhang Guoqing quickly followed.

When the sky was barely lit, everyone gathered to eat breakfast not long after. Old Mrs. Cheng could be seen bringing her little grandson, Cheng Jingbo, over with a smile.

"Did you sleep well last night? If anything’s not right, let Jiao Jiao change it for you."

Mother Zhang shook her head with a smile, "It’s great. You should sleep a little more."

"Today, I’ll go shopping with you. Xiao Zheng, don’t worry and go to work, there’s your little aunt at home."

Zhou Xiaozheng nodded, "I have a meeting in the morning, and I will come to find you in the afternoon."

Mr. Zhang quickly refused, "Work is important. Go take care of your own business, don’t let it affect your official tasks."

"It won’t matter," Zhou Xiaozheng looked at his son-in-law, "Let’s meet for lunch at the same roast duck place we went last time."

Zhang Guoqing laughed, "Dad, you might as well just eat steamed buns. We should eat wherever is convenient, no need to go back specially, it’s too troublesome."

Old Mrs. Cheng followed up with a laugh, "Xiao Wu is right. You take care of your own business first; we are all family, no need to stand on ceremony. Your little aunt will bring you some roast duck."

Zhou Xiaozheng was both crying and laughing, as if he was the one who was gluttonous. Seeing that everyone agreed, he could only nod helplessly.

For two consecutive days, Old Mrs. Cheng took Mother Zhang and the others to visit various major attractions in Beijing, providing the elderly couple and Xi Zi a good look at the wonders.

By the third day, Mr. Zhang noticed that Old Mrs. Cheng was quite exhausted and was no longer willing to let her tire herself by going out. He used the excuse that he needed to rest and regain his energy.

The next day, Zhang Guoqing saw him stuck in the Big Courtyard with nowhere to go. The couple discussed for a while and decided to take them to the theater for some tea. High-intensity wandering was clearly not suitable for Mr. Zhang and his group.

After that, the couple accompanied their in-laws to stroll through hutongs and listen to operas, while Xi Zi and the others, since they befriended some kids from the Cheng family, were no longer willing to leave the Big Courtyard.

The days passed quietly, and in the blink of an eye, Mr. and Mrs. Zhang had been here for a week.

That evening, after dinner, Zhou Xiaozheng sat in the living room with Mr. Zhang, and they chatted casually. Unexpectedly, the in-laws suddenly mentioned returning home.

"Second Brother, you’ve only been here a few days. Is it inconvenient to get in and out of the Big Courtyard? Shouldn’t Xiao Wu and Jiao Jiao take you to the courtyard house for a while?"

Mr. Zhang laughed and shook his head, "It’s very safe here, nothing inconvenient. We’ve seen all the bustling spots in Beijing and tasted the good food. Xiao Wu and the others are doing well here; it puts my mind at ease. Now I’m thinking about home, not sure how things are there."
